Output ebe95c779ec2d6b83b425bd3202c49c1e67e40a51c2c27ef37069486df14d9fb:2

value
33636472
script pubkey
OP_0 OP_PUSHBYTES_20 36b7e802505c96a8059c73bd0a400016941ef729
address
bc1qx6m7sqjstjt2spvuww7s5sqqz62paaefh3fv7w
transaction
ebe95c779ec2d6b83b425bd3202c49c1e67e40a51c2c27ef37069486df14d9fb
confirmations
127
spent
true